Transaction 51fb88679427df611b8e27f3ad7d654990b9391d7b74cc163a2a3ef3fcad6f3a
1 Input
1 Output
-
51fb88679427df611b8e27f3ad7d654990b9391d7b74cc163a2a3ef3fcad6f3a:0
- value
- 548544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a9b8e085df0e7d1c2b077c1a9f59943da82c9e2 OP_EQUAL
- address
- 32f72bkyU4PS17iJEk9dFttSAhz5pcjnuc